What is a Registered Agent?
A registered agent is an person or business entity appointed to receive official papers and notifications on behalf of a business. This includes important communications such as tax forms, legal summons, and compliance documents. The registered agent acts as the point of contact between the company and the government, ensuring that necessary paperwork is processed in a prompt manner.
In most jurisdictions, having a designated agent is a legal requirement for companies and limited liability companies. The designated representative must have a physical address in the region where the business is registered and be reachable during business hours to accept service of process and other notices. This setup provides a level of confidentiality for entrepreneurs, as it keeps their personal address off the public record.
Choosing the right registered agent is crucial for maintaining compliance and avoiding potential legal issues. Various agent service providers offer different services, including mail services, annual compliance reminders, and additional offerings. Businesses can choose local, nationwide, or virtual registered agents, depending on their specific needs and wants.

Authorized Representative Requirements
Licensed agents play a vital role in a enterprise's lawful and functional system. To act as a authorized agent, an person or group must fulfill particular requirements that differ by jurisdiction. Typically, a authorized representative must be a inhabitant of the region where the company is formed or keep a real office there. This ensures that the registered representative can be easily available to receive important legal papers, such as delivery of notice or fiscal alerts.
In addition to being a resident, registered representatives must also be at least 18 years old or older. For corporations serving as registered agents, they must be permitted to carry out operations in the state where they function. This criteria ensures that they adhere with regional regulations while discharging their responsibilities. Companies should verify that their designated registered representative fulfills these requirements to steer clear of potential law-related problems.

Costs and Prices of Registered Agent Services
When evaluating registered agent solutions, understanding the costs involved is important for companies. The charges for hiring a registered agent can fluctuate considerably based on the company and the quality of service offered. Standard services typically range from fifty to three hundred dollars per year. Methods to Alter Your Registered Agent
Altering the registered agent can be a straightforward process that varies slightly by jurisdiction, so it can be important to familiarize yourself with the particular requirements in the local area. To commence, you should choose a new registered agent provider that fits the business needs. Look for a trustworthy and qualified company that delivers registered agent services, evaluating factors such as availability, compliance support, and any extra services that might be beneficial for your business.
When you have chosen a new registered agent, the following step is to finalize the necessary paperwork to legally designate the new agent as the new agent for service of process. This usually involves submitting a registered agent change form, which can frequently be found on the local Secretary of State website. Make sure to collect any required information, including information about your current and new registered agents, and be mindful of any submission fees that might apply.
Following filing the change of registered agent paperwork, it can be important to verify that the transition is successfully processed. You should receive notification from the state confirming the change, and it can be a good practice to keep this correspondence for your records. Additionally, let know your previous registered agent of the change, and ensure that all legal and compliance documents are updated to show the new registered agent's information. Following these steps will assist to maintain the business’s compliance and eliminate any future complications.
